The Galleries at Turney Designed by [merz] project

August 10, 2008 Filed Under: Architecture, Home Improvement

The Galleries at Turney is the first new residential project in Arizona to achieve LEED-H certification. Located near the Biltmore shopping area, The Galleries consists of eight residences in a quiet gated enclave with spectacular views of the downtown Phoenix skyline and the surrounding natural beauty of Camelback Mountain and the Phoenix North Mountain Preserve.

Komatsu Introduces D375A-6 Dozer

August 29, 2009 Filed Under: Construction
Komatsu Introduces D375A-6 Dozer

Komatsu America Corp. introduced its new D375A-6 crawler dozer for use in mining and heavy construction applications. Following an extensive amount of customer input and feedback, the new dozer includes technological enhancements for even greater productivity. The new D375A-6 is powered by a highly efficient Komatsu SAA6D170E-5 engine with an operating weight of 157,940 lbs. The dozer delivers 636 Gross HP at 1800 RPM while maintaining high fuel efficiency...

B.L. Downey Company Receives DuPont Star Coater(SM) Certification

September 4, 2008 Filed Under: Construction

B.L. Downey Company LLC is pleased to announce it has achieved DuPont Star CoaterSM certification for REBAR, after an audit of its operations by DuPont CoatingSolutions. The audit focused on process review, part preparation, application, cure, quality tests, employee training, safety, customer satisfaction, DuPont loyalty and federal, state and local code compliance.
